However in this article aside from showing you these native approaches to reading files using Excel Macros you can read CSV files and other structured data … the price is right 2000 aprilWebJul 30, 2013 · The binary search will terminate "somewhere in the list of values that match". If you expect there are multiple values that might match, you need to work backwards from that point (towards A) until you don't get a match, and again forwards (towards Z). This is how you find all the partial matches. the price is right 2001 2002
